Ingredients

  • 12 slices thick-sliced bacon, halved crosswise

  • 1 egg yolk, lightly beaten

  • cup carbonated water

  • ¾ cup all-purpose flour

  • Vegetable oil

  • Powdered sugar (optional)

  • Pure maple syrup

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 400°F. Line two 15x10x1-inch baking pans or shallow roasting pans with foil. Place wire racks in the pans. Arrange bacon pieces in a single layer on the racks. Bake for 20 to 25 minutes or until crisp. Remove bacon and drain on paper towels; cool.

  2. For batter, in a medium bowl combine egg yolk and carbonated water. Stir in flour just until moistened (batter should be slightly lumpy).

  3. In a medium heavy saucepan heat 1 1/2 to 2 inches of oil to 375°F. Dip bacon into batter, letting excess batter drip off. Fry bacon, a few pieces at a time, in hot oil for 2 to 3 minutes or until lightly browned. Remove bacon with a slotted spoon and drain on paper towels. Keep fried pieces warm in a 200°F oven while frying remaining pieces. If desired, sprinkle with powdered sugar. Serve with maple syrup.
